Medway Street

Client: Wellsborough Developments

Date: 2004-present

Proposed Use: Residential / retail / café

Former Use: Pub

Gross Area: 1,622 sq.m

Accommodation: 14 flats, ground floor retail / café

Construction Value: £2.5m

This small scheme is for a former pub site next to the old DoE Marsham St buildings, now occupied by a new headquarters for the Home Office by Terry Farrell. The design does not try to compete with the scale or language of this context, but instead offers a discreet, subtle, but still contemporary piece of urban infill that develops ideas from the practice's other work in Westminster.

The red-brown brick used on the façade has been chosen to blend in with the surrounding Conservation Area, but is used with deep reveals and floor to ceiling windows that emphasise the vertical rhythm of the street. .
